Lawtey residents ask delegation to restore caution light, study speeds and repair DOT sidewalks

Residents of Lawtey (transcript spelled 'Lawdy') asked the delegation to investigate removal of a caution light at County Road 200B and Lake Street, request a speed study on County Road 225, and press FDOT for sidewalk repairs that residents said are hazardous.

A Lawtey resident asked the Bradford County delegation to help restore a caution light at the intersection of County Road 200B (Lake Street) and County Road 225, to order a speed study on County Road 225 between U.S. 301 and State Road 16, and to press the Florida Department of Transportation to repair sidewalks in town.

The resident said DOT and local officials could not explain why a caution light that had been present at the intersection was removed sometime last year and asked the delegation to find out the reason and work to restore the light. She also said vehicle speeds increase from 30 mph at U.S. 301 to 55 mph approaching Clay County and requested a formal speed study and pavement maintenance on County Road 225.

Delegation members said they would follow up with DOT and county staff to determine why the light was removed and to request a speed study and sidewalk maintenance; no formal action was taken at the meeting.
